Que es INT en ensamblador?

¿Qué es INT en ensamblador?

INT es una instrucción en lenguaje ensamblador para procesadores x86 que genera una interrupción de software . Toma el número de interrupción formateado como un valor de byte . Cuando se escribe en lenguaje ensamblador, la instrucción se escribe así: INT X.

¿Qué contiene el registro DX?

Registro DX: El registro DX es el registro de datos. En algunas operaciones se indica mediante este registro el número de puerto de entrada/salida, y en las operaciones de multiplicación y división de 16 bits se utiliza junto con el acumulador AX.

¿Cuáles son los tipos de registros que hay?

Tipos de registros

  • Los registros de datos se usan para guardar números enteros.
  • Los registros de memoria se usan para guardar exclusivamente direcciones de memoria.
  • Los registros de propósito general (en inglés GPRs o General Purpose Registers) pueden guardar tanto datos como direcciones.
LEER:   Quien es drow?

¿Qué es el registro de código de un programa?

Registro CS. El DOS almacena la dirección inicial del segmento de código de un programa en el registro CS. Esta dirección de segmento, mas un valor de desplazamiento en el registro apuntador de instrucción (IP), indica la dirección de una instrucción que es buscada para su ejecución.

¿Cuál es la diferencia entre cx y ax?

CX es usado por algunas instrucciones como contador (en ciclos, rotaciones..) DX o registro de datos; a veces se usa junto con AX en esas instrucciones especiales mencionadas.

¿Cuál es la función del registro de datos?

Se utiliza como contador en bucles (instrucción LOOP), en operaciones con cadenas (usando el prefijo REP) y en desplazamientos y rotaciones (usando el registro CL en los dos últimos casos). DX = Registro de datos, dividido en DH y DL.

¿Cómo se llama el Registro Auxiliar de un programador?

-BP- Base pointer: Se usa como registro auxiliar. El programador puede usarlo para su provecho.

Comienza escribiendo tu búsqueda y pulsa enter para buscar. Presiona ESC para cancelar.

Volver arriba